Time and method of cattle cultivation
The breeding season is generally in spring and autumn. Autumn cultivation from October 1st to early November. Cover with arched plastic film around November 10th. Planting can be done from March to mid-May in spring, those covered with film can be planted in March, and those cultivated in the open field can be planted after frost. 1. Site selection and preparation: sandy loam soil with deep soil, loose soil and good drainage is suitable. After selecting the plot of land, plow it deeply, rake it carefully, and then dig furrows and ridges. The ridge is 40-50 cm wide and about 25 cm high. To prevent the ridge from collapsing in rainy weather, both sides must be compacted. 2. Sowing: Collect the pods when they are mature, remove the seeds after drying, and select suitable seeds for sowing. Soak the seeds in warm water at a suitable temperature for several hours before sowing to speed up germination. Advance when the seeds germinate; sow seeds, use chemical seed dressing and disinfection, and then dig furrows on the top of the ridge for sowing. 3. Seedling management: When the seedlings grow to 1-2 true leaves and 2-3 true leaves, thinning is performed once, and then the seedlings are established. When setting seedlings, the distance between seedlings should be controlled at 7-10cm for easy management. The time interval between establishing seedlings determines the time to market. 4. Field management: Weed according to the growth conditions of the field and seedlings. Fertilization is required 3 times during the growing season. For the first time, when the plants grow to more than 30cm, topdress 10 kilograms of urea per acre; for the second time, during the growing season, topdress 8 kilograms of urea per acre; for the third time, when the fleshy roots swell, topdress diammonium phosphate per acre. 10 kg, potassium sulfate 5 kg.
